J Garrison
Before I respond, I would like to declare that I am in no means a scrooge or poor sport. I do find it interesting that you, along with everyone else who has responded thus far, seems to think this is normal/acceptable behavior. I'm 30 years old and have never actually seen this. I thought it was something you only see in movies. I know that if this happened to me, the next time I saw my friends it would be a topic of conversation.

With that said...
Going from house to house seems like a reasonable thing to do. The problem with doing this in an apartment building is that, most likely, every apartment dweller is going to be subjected to the same caroling for every apartment at least on that floor of the building and possibly for above and below floors. To think that the person in apartment B isn't going to hear the caroling going on in apartment A across the hall and apartment C, D, E, F, G, H, and I down the hall isn't realistic. Not everyone works and operates on the same hours. If you're caroling on a floor with 9 apartments and one person works at night and sleeps during the day, this may be deemed very inconsiderate and obnoxious.

Perhaps you should consider caroling not for each apartment, but for each floor of the apartment building.
